Leren
Layer 2 Ethereum Schaling: Gebaseerde en Native Rollups Uitgelegd
token_sale
token_sale
Doe mee aan de Yellow Network Token Sale en verzeker uw plekDoe nu mee
token_sale

Layer 2 Ethereum Schaling: Gebaseerde en Native Rollups Uitgelegd

Layer 2 Ethereum Schaling: Gebaseerde en Native Rollups Uitgelegd

Ethereum's schaalbaarheidsreis is gevormd door de noodzaak om het "blockchain-dilemma" aan te pakken, dat stelt dat beveiliging, decentralisatie en schaalbaarheid niet tegelijkertijd binnen een Layer 1 (L1) netwerk kunnen worden bereikt.

Wat te Weten Over Ethereum Rollups?

Ethereum heeft historisch prioriteit gegeven aan beveiliging en decentralisatie, waardoor schaalbaarheid een uitdaging bleef. Met stijgende transactiekosten en vertraagde verwerkingstijden naarmate de vraag van gebruikers toeneemt, zijn Layer 2 (L2) oplossingen, met name rollups, kritieke tools geworden om deze beperkingen te overwinnen.

Rollups schalen Ethereum door berekeningen van de hoofdketen te verplaatsen, transacties in gecomprimeerde batches samen te bundelen en ze ter verificatie naar L1 door te sturen. Deze aanpak maakt snellere en goedkopere transacties mogelijk, terwijl Ethereum's beveiliging en decentralisatie behouden blijven.

Rollups zijn sinds 2020 centraal geworden in Ethereum's roadmap, waardoor gebruikssituaties zoals on-chain gaming en snelle gedecentraliseerde financiën (DeFi) levensvatbaar worden. Onder de rollup-types hebben zk-rollups dominantie verworven vanwege hun efficiëntie en veiligheid, gebruikmakend van zero-knowledge bewijzen voor validatie. Projecten zoals zkSync Era en Linea leiden in adoptie, met lage kosten en hoge doorvoer.

Ondanks hun succes, worden rollups geconfronteerd met uitdagingen zoals fragmentatie van staat en liquiditeit over verschillende rollup-netwerken, wat de gebruikerservaring en adoptie door ontwikkelaars beperkt. Bovendien zijn veel rollups nog steeds afhankelijk van gecentraliseerde componenten zoals sequencers voor transactiebestelling, wat risico's van censuur met zich meebrengt.

Ethereum's roadmap streeft ernaar om rollups naar volledige decentralisatie te ontwikkelen door deze "zijwieltjes" - gecentraliseerde veiligheidsmaatregelen - te verwijderen en vertrouwenloze systemen voor transactiesequencing en bewijsvoering mogelijk te maken.

Voor Ethereum-gebruikers zijn rollups essentieel om kosten te verlagen en transactiesnelheden te verbeteren. Ze moeten zich echter bewust zijn van de afwegingen tussen verschillende rollup-architecturen - zoals zk-rollups versus optimistische rollups - en de voortdurende evolutie richting decentralisatie. Naarmate rollups volwassen worden, zullen ze een steeds kritieker rol spelen in het vormgeven van Ethereum's schaalbaarheid en gebruikerservaring.

Belangrijkste Kenmerken van Gebaseerde Rollups:

  • Gedecentraliseerde Sequencing: In plaats van gebruik te maken van een aangewezen sequencer of gecentraliseerde entiteit, wordt de transactiebestelling afgehandeld door Ethereum's eigen validators. Deze aanpak vermindert aanzienlijk de risico's van censuur en transactie-manipulatie, en zorgt voor eerlijke en transparante verwerking.

  • Naadloze L1-Integratie: Ethereum’s L1-infrastructuur regelt consensus, datapublicatie en afwikkeling, terwijl de uitvoering plaatsvindt op het rollup-netwerk. Dit ontwerp erft Ethereum's beveiligings- en decentralisatie-eigenschappen zonder nieuwe lagen van vertrouwensaugementen toe te voegen.

  • Vereenvoudigde Architectuur: Door de noodzaak van gecentraliseerde sequencers te verwijderen, creëren gebaseerde rollups een slanker en meer aan Ethereum-uitgelijnd transactieverwerkingsmodel. Deze vereenvoudiging vermindert ook de afhankelijkheid van externe governance-structuren, waardoor ze op de lange termijn robuuster worden.

Voordelen van Gebaseerde Rollups:

  • Sterkere beveiliging en decentralisatie door gebruik te maken van Ethereum-validators.

  • Verminderde afhankelijkheid van externe governance en infrastructuurproviders.

  • Een gestroomlijnd systeem dat trouw blijft aan Ethereum's oorspronkelijke ethos.

Uitdagingen en Overwegingen:

  • Doorvoerbeperkingen: Aangezien Ethereum's L1-bloktijden langer zijn (ongeveer 12 seconden), kan de finaliteit van transacties langzamer zijn vergeleken met rollups met speciale sequencers.

  • Innovaties voor Voorbevestiging: Om latentieproblemen te verminderen, onderzoeken ontwikkelaars technieken voor voorbevestiging die het mogelijk maken dat transacties voorlopig worden bevestigd voordat ze volledig in L1-blokken worden opgenomen.

Belangrijkste Kenmerken van Native Rollups:

  • Directe Ethereum Validatie: Native rollups elimineren de behoefte aan aanvullende bewijssystemen door gebruik te maken van Ethereum's ingebouwde transactie-validatieregels. Dit zorgt ervoor dat staatsoverdrachten binnen Ethereum zelf worden geverifieerd, waardoor de rollup-implementaties minder complex worden.

  • Automatische Upgrades: Aangezien native rollups binnen de kerninfrastructuur van Ethereum opereren, erven ze automatisch protocolupgrades. Dit vermijdt governance-knelpunten die vaak traditionele rollups beïnvloeden die handmatige goedkeuringen van de veiligheidsraad vereisen.

  • Vereenvoudigd Beveiligingsmodel: Door transactiegegevens direct naar Ethereum te sturen en gebruik te maken van zijn validatiemechanismen, verminderen native rollups de behoefte aan onafhankelijke beveiligingsmodellen, waardoor het systeem meer verenigd en gemakkelijker te onderhouden is.

Voordelen van Native Rollups:

  • Grotere Vertrouweloosheid: Transacties worden direct door Ethereum geverifieerd, wat zorgt voor overeenstemming met zijn beveiligingsgaranties.

  • Lagere Onderhoudslast: Rollup-teams profiteren van Ethereum’s beveiliging en consensusmechanismen, waardoor operationele complexiteit wordt verminderd.

  • Betere Interoperabiliteit van Ecosystemen: Aangezien validatie op het niveau van het Ethereum-protocol plaatsvindt, maken native rollups naadlozere interacties tussen verschillende L2-oplossingen mogelijk.

Uitdagingen en Overwegingen:

  • Vereiste Protocol Wijzigingen: Het implementeren van de EXECUTE-precompile vereist wijzigingen in Ethereum's protocol, wat coördinatie door hard forks en ecosysteem-brede upgrades vereist.

  • MEV-gebaseerde Centralisatierisico’s: Miner Extractable Value (MEV) kan competitie voor transactiebestelling introduceren, waardoor aspecten van het rollup-uitvoeringsproces mogelijk worden gecentraliseerd. Mechanismen om deze risico's te beperken worden onderzocht.

Kiezen Tussen Gebaseerde en Native Rollups

Ethereum's Layer 2-ecosysteem blijft evolueren, en zowel gebaseerde als native rollups bieden innovatieve benaderingen van scaling terwijl ze beveiliging en decentralisatie handhaven. Elk model biedt verschillende voordelen en afwegingen, waardoor de keuze ertussen afhangt van de prioriteiten van ontwikkelaars, gebruikers en de bredere Ethereum-gemeenschap.

Gebaseerde rollups integreren met Ethereum's bestaande validator-gebaseerde sequencermodel, waardoor decentralisatie wordt versterkt door gebruik te maken van Layer 1-validators om transacties te ordenen. Dit vermindert de afhankelijkheid van gecentraliseerde sequencers, maar kan vertraging inhouden door Ethereum’s blocktijden. In tegenstelling hiermee zijn native rollups dieper ingebed binnen Ethereum's kernprotocol, waarmee de noodzaak voor afzonderlijke sequencemechanismen en bewijssystemen wordt geëlimineerd. Hoewel deze integratie de transactievalidatie stroomlijnt, vereist het aanzienlijke protocolupgrades, mogelijk via hard forks.

Beveiliging blijft een sterk punt voor beide benaderingen, aangezien zij Ethereum’s robuuste Layer 1 beveiligingsmodel erven. Native rollups gaan echter een stap verder door gebruik te maken van ingebouwde validatiemechanismen van Ethereum, waardoor de behoefte aan fraudepbewijzen of zero-knowledge bewijzen wordt weggenomen. Governance is een ander belangrijk verschil - gebaseerde rollups zijn in lijn met Ethereum's economische model, maar hebben nog steeds onafhankelijke governance nodig, terwijl native rollups automatisch Ethereum-upgrades aannemen, wat governance-overhead vermindert.

Uiteindelijk zal de adoptie van gebaseerde of native rollups afhangen van Ethereum's langetermijnvisie voor schaalbaarheid. Hoewel gebaseerde rollups een onmiddellijke weg vooruit bieden met minimale protocolwijzigingen, bieden native rollups een meer geïntegreerde, langetermijnoplossing voor efficiëntie en schaalbaarheid. Naarmate rolluptechnologie volwassen wordt, zal het Layer 2-landschap van Ethereum blijven verbeteren, waardoor snellere, goedkopere en veiligere transacties wereldwijd aan gebruikers worden gebracht.

Disclaimer: De informatie in dit artikel is uitsluitend bedoeld voor educatieve doeleinden en mag niet worden beschouwd als financieel of juridisch advies. Doe altijd uw eigen onderzoek of raadpleeg een professional bij het omgaan met cryptocurrency-activa.
Nieuwste leerartikelen
Alle leerartikelen tonen